The login form for Google Picasa is only displayed if no username and password were provided in the Output Directory Tab of the Add/Edit Format form or alternatively if the entered data was wrong (like password changed in the meantime).

The login form for Picasa WEB Albums is shown below:

In the case that Google requires the user to enter a CAPTCHA, this form will change its layout to accommodate the captcha input controls.

The username and password entered in this form are not saved to any configuration files as opposed to the ones entered in the Output Directory Tab. If you have made any error when providing the login data in the format definition, please correct it there. The reason of handling those two input forms differently is that we want to give users that do not want to have any of their login data saved locally on the computer an opportunity to do it.

If you press Cancel, the Picasa upload will be skipped. The conversion of the files and the upload to other sites are not influenced in any way by this.
